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2006.02.05;
Скачать: CL | DM;

Вниз

Чтобы не было никаких ошибок на английском. Чтоб все по-русски..   Найти похожие ветки 

 
tamroF ©   (2006-01-06 00:27) [0]

Приветствую!
Возникла огромная необходимость обрабатывать исключения при вводе данных (БД Oracle 8i).
Подключаюсь через ODAC, сетка TDBGridEh.

В общем то, указанье мне было следующее: "Чтобы не было никаких ошибок на английском. Чтоб все по-русски.."
Вот к примеру, есть поле GOD_POTR - NUMBER(4), содержит год, например 2004.
В TOraTable.BeforePost делаю нужные проверки и сообщения на русском.
Но если в ячейку ввести такой год "1111111111111111111111111111111111111111111111111111111", то даже не доходя до
OnBeforePost, вываливается сообщение (возможно от сетки)

СООБЩЕНИЕ: "1111111111111111111111111111111111111111111111111111111" is not a valid integer value for field "GOD_POTR"

Вопрос: как отловить?..
Благодарю.


 
Fay ©   (2006-01-06 00:37) [1]

Файл DBConsts.pas скопируй куда-нибудь, добавь к проекту, исправь.


 
tamroF ©   (2006-01-06 00:45) [2]

Хм.. Спасибо!



Страницы: 1 вся ветка

Текущий архив: 2006.02.05;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.031 c
15-1137133566
ZeroDivide
2006-01-13 09:26
2006.02.05
Меня тут на sql.ru почикали.., но я не удивляюсь.... хотя вопрос


15-1136257542
Искатель
2006-01-03 06:05
2006.02.05
Где можно дать объявление о поиске работы по написанию программ?


8-1124966742
Irinka
2005-08-25 14:45
2006.02.05
Как проигрывать звуковые файлы


1-1135680585
MaxY
2005-12-27 13:49
2006.02.05
Синхронизация скроллинга в нескольких гридах !?


2-1137410005
Tigraman
2006-01-16 14:13
2006.02.05
Memo и checkbox